🖤 Design: Darkness Done Right
The KURO Edition is based on the facelifted Magnite N-Connecta variant, but it’s the visual overhaul that truly sets it apart. The exterior is drenched in Onyx Black, complemented by silver inserts and blacked-out 16-inch diamond-cut alloy wheels. From the Piano Black grille to the Resin Black front and rear skid plates, every detail has been meticulously curated to deliver a stealthy, premium look.
Gloss Black roof rails and black door handles complete the all-black ensemble, giving the KURO Edition a cohesive and aggressive stance. It’s not just a paint job—it’s a mood.
🖤 Interior: Where Minimalism Meets Sophistication
Step inside, and the KURO Edition continues its dark theme with an all-black cabin. Black upholstery, black dashboard accents, and a black headliner create a cocoon-like environment that feels both sporty and refined. The illuminated glove box adds a touch of flair, while the auto-dimming IRVM and i-key auto unlock system bring convenience to the forefront.
The digital instrument cluster and central touchscreen infotainment system are paired with an Arkamys sound system, ensuring that your driving experience is as immersive as it is intuitive. Rear AC vents and automatic climate control round out the comfort features, making the KURO Edition a surprisingly plush ride for its segment.
⚙️ Powertrain Options: Versatility Under the Hood
The KURO Edition retains the same powertrain options as the standard Magnite, offering two distinct choices:
- 1.0-litre Naturally Aspirated Petrol: Produces 71 bhp and 96 Nm of torque. Available with a 5-speed manual or a 5-speed AMT gearbox. This engine is also compatible with CNG, adding an eco-friendly option for urban commuters.
- 1.0-litre Turbo-Petrol: Delivers 99 bhp and up to 160 Nm of torque (CVT) or 152 Nm (manual). This variant offers a more spirited drive and is ideal for those who want a bit more punch from their daily driver.
While the KURO Edition doesn’t introduce new mechanical upgrades, it smartly packages existing options in a way that feels fresh and premium.
🛡️ Safety: Style Without Compromise
Nissan has made safety a priority with the KURO Edition. The Magnite recently earned a 5-star rating in the Global NCAP crash tests, a significant achievement for a vehicle in this price bracket. Standard safety features include dual airbags, ABS with EBD, rear parking sensors, and a rear-view camera.
The KURO Edition also benefits from Nissan’s “One Car, One World” strategy, which emphasizes global safety standards and innovation. It’s a reassuring reminder that style doesn’t come at the cost of substance.
💰 Pricing and Market Positioning
Priced between ₹8.31 lakh and ₹10.97 lakh (ex-showroom), the KURO Edition sits comfortably in the mid-to-high range of the Magnite lineup. It’s aimed at young professionals and style-conscious families who want a vehicle that stands out without breaking the bank.
Compared to rivals like the Tata Punch, Hyundai Exter, and Maruti Brezza, the KURO Edition offers a unique value proposition: premium styling, respectable performance, and a feature-rich cabin—all wrapped in a striking black package.
